Real Estate Revolution: The Rise of copyright Payments
The real estate industry experiencing a dramatic transformation as copyright embraces mainstream acceptance. Buyers and sellers alike are exploring blockchain-based currenc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and others to facilitate real estate transactions. This movement promises enhanced transparency in the process, minimizing reliance on traditional intermediaries.
Proponents of this shift argue that copyright transactions can expedite real estate dealings, offering a faster and more cost-effective alternative.
However, there are challenges to overcome. Regulatory uncertainty surrounding cryptocurrencies, combined with their price fluctuations, create potential risks for both buyers and sellers.
Despite these concerns, the implementation of copyright in real estate appears to be a phenomenon with significant potential for revolution. As technology evolves and regulations mature, the prospect of copyright-powered real estate transactions brightens.
